Diferencia entre revisiones de «Unity Audio - Efectos de Sonido»
Ir a la navegación
Ir a la búsqueda
Imagen obtenido de https://docs.unity3d.com/Manual/AudioFiles.html
Línea 15: | Línea 15: | ||
:* Audio Source: Componente asociado a un GameObject que permite reproducir un AudioClip. | :* Audio Source: Componente asociado a un GameObject que permite reproducir un AudioClip. | ||
:* Audio Listener: Componente necesario para que se pueda escuchar cualquier Audio Source. | :* Audio Listener: Componente necesario para que se pueda escuchar cualquier Audio Source. | ||
+ | |||
+ | |||
+ | |||
+ | * Para realizar esta sección vamos a descargar los siguientes recursos: | ||
+ | :* Efecto de explosión de [https://freesound.org/people/IdkMrGarcia/ IdkMrGarcia]: https://freesound.org/people/IdkMrGarcia/sounds/446624/ | ||
+ | :* Efecto de disparo de [https://freesound.org/people/fastson/ FastSon]: https://freesound.org/people/fastson/sounds/399067/ | ||
+ | :* Música de fondo Binderbergin: http://dig.ccmixter.org/files/Robbero/53179 | ||
+ | ::Bilderbergin by Robbero (c) copyright 2016 Licensed under a Creative Commons Attribution (3.0) license. | ||
<br /> | <br /> | ||
+ | |||
=Audio Clips= | =Audio Clips= | ||
Revisión del 09:58 29 jul 2019
Introducción
- Más información en este enlace.
- El audio es uno de los elementos más importantes para conseguir una correcta ambientación y experiencia cuando jugamos a u juego.
- El uso de audio incluye:
- Música ambiental
- Efectos de sonidos (explosiones, aceleraciones, choques, disparos,aciertos al disparar...)
- En lo referente al manejo de Audios, Unity maneja tres conceptos:
- Audio Clips: Son los ficheros de audio que guardan el sonido que queremos reproducir
- Audio Source: Componente asociado a un GameObject que permite reproducir un AudioClip.
- Audio Listener: Componente necesario para que se pueda escuchar cualquier Audio Source.
- Para realizar esta sección vamos a descargar los siguientes recursos:
- Efecto de explosión de IdkMrGarcia: https://freesound.org/people/IdkMrGarcia/sounds/446624/
- Efecto de disparo de FastSon: https://freesound.org/people/fastson/sounds/399067/
- Música de fondo Binderbergin: http://dig.ccmixter.org/files/Robbero/53179
- Bilderbergin by Robbero (c) copyright 2016 Licensed under a Creative Commons Attribution (3.0) license.
Audio Clips
- Más información en este enlace.
- Son los sonidos que queremos reproducir.
- Unity los almacena en forma de Assets dentro de la ventana de proyecto.
- Tendrán un formato determinado, como mp3, wav,...
- Los formatos de audio que Unity soporta son los siguientes:
Audio Source
- Más información en este enlace.
- Un Audio Source es un componente que se asocia a un GameObject en la escena y permite reproducir un AudioClip.
- Controla:
- Volumen.
- Tono.
- Cuando un AudioClip es reproducido teniendo en cuenta aspectos 3D o no (por ejemplo, si es tratado como 3D, al aumentar la distancia el volumen disminuye, el sonido puede venir de un altavoz derecho y pasar a un izquierdo al desplazarse la fuente de audio).
Audio Listener
- Más información en este enlace.
- Componente necesario para que se pueda escuchar cualquier Audio Source.
- Todo proyecto que se cree en Unity viene con un Audio Listener creado por defecto asociado como un componente a la cámara:
- NOTA IMPORTANTE: Sólo puede haber un Audio Listener activo en la escena.
- Un Audio Listener representa el punto desde el cual el jugador va a escuchar el sonido.
- La posición del Audio Listener va a influir en el sonido que escucha el jugador debido a que va a poder tener en cuenta la distancia entre el Audio Listener y los Audio Sources que reproducen los Audio Clips.
- Así la frecuencia del sonido va a variar si nos acercamos o nos alejamos del Audio Source produciendo un efecto Doppler.
Investigación
-- Ángel D. Fernández González -- (2018).